LSRT SCHOLARSHIP FOUNDATION

I.   NAME OF SCHOLARSHIP – Joe Schwartz Memorial Scholarship  Joe Schwartz was one of the past presidents of LSRT. He was also a life member of LSRT and was a true professional in every aspect of the word.

II.        SPONSOR     Louisiana Society of Radiologic Technologists

III.       SCHOLARSHIP FUND

A.        Deposits made in separate account

B.         Receive cash from donations

IV.       AMOUNT OF AWARD

A.        Minimum amount awarded per year  ‑  $250.00

B.         Maximum amount awarded per year  ‑  $1000.00

V.        AWARDED ANNUALLY AT LSRT ANNUAL MEETING

May be mailed post meeting.

VI.       APPLICATION TIMETABLE

A.  Announcement/Applications printed in January issue of Focal Spot Monitor.  Applications may be requested in January.

B.   Application deadline is April 15th (prior to LSRT Spring Board Meeting).

C.   Notification of decisions prior to LSRT Annual Meeting.

VII.  NUMBER OF SCHOLARSHIPS AWARDED

SELECT FROM THE FOLLOWING CATEGORIES

A.  Hospital based program

B.   College based program

C.  Specialty modality graduate program

D.  Post graduate B.S. / Masters / Ph.D. studies (degree)

VIII.  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S

A.    Louisiana resident for past 5 years.

B.   Student member / Technologist member of LSRT in good standing (must have been a member  of LSRT for a minimum of 6 months)

C.  Cumulative GPA of 3.0 (B) or above

D.  Currently enrolled as a full‑time student in one of the following appropriately accredited Radiologic Technology Programs

1.  Radiography – As a Junior (first‑year) or Senior (second-year) level student.  Exclude college based students in Pre‑Radiologic Technology Programs

a.  Hospital based program ‑ Must be a student in a program for not less than 6 months.

b.  College based program ‑ Must be a student in a program for not less than 1 semester of Radiologic Technology Curriculum

2.  Radiation Therapy Technology

3.  Diagnostic Medical Sonography

4.  Nuclear Medicine Technology

5.   Medicinal Dosimetry

6.   Post Primary Certifications

7.  ARRT/NMTCB Registered (registry eligible) and currently  pursuing Baccalaureate/Masters/Ph.D. Degree in field related to radiological sciences (Education, Administration, Radiologist Assistant, etc)

E.  Must have been a student in a program for not less than one college semester or six months.

F. Actively involved in Professional Society as well as community

G. Provide list of Extracurricular Activities (Scholastic and Honorary Awards)

H.  Provide 3 letters of recommendation (must be sent directly from these individuals listed below to the LSRT Executive Secretary‑ Membership)

1.  Program director/Department chairperson

2.  Clinical instructor (current or previous)

3.  Faculty member

4.  Employer

5.  Character reference

I.  Provide written statement with student’s expression of interest in the field of study, future plans, explanation of financial need, and why he/she feels qualified to receive the scholarship.

J.  Provide true and correct statements on the completed application.

IX.  SELECTION COMMITTEE:

Five members shall serve on the selection committee:  The LSRT Board of Directors, Chairperson of the Council of Educators or Council Member, and Chairperson on the Student Affairs Committee.  If a committee member is associated with a student, that member would then be ineligible for selection and the Board shall appoint an alternate.

X.  SELECTION GUIDELINES

A.   Application packet complete

B.  GPA/ Official Transcript

C.   Financial Need

D.  Recommendations

E.  Extracurricular Activities

F.   Active professional/community involvement

G.   LSRT member

H.  Louisiana resident

I.  Written statement from Program Director/Dean of the School demonstrating level of classification and expected date of graduation.  (must be sent directly to the LSRT Executive Secretary‑Membership)
